Perfil do câncer de próstata no hospital de clínicas de Porto Alegre

Abstract: RESUMOOBJETIVO. Determinar as características do adenocarcinoma prostático em um programa de rastreamento voluntário realizado no Hospital de Clínicas de Porto Alegre. Métodos. Durante cinco anos consecutivos, 3.056 pacientes foram submetidos a um estudo transversal com o objetivo de determinar a prevalência e características do câncer de próstata na amostra. “…Orientation should include early diagnosis, the risks of overdiagnosis and overtreatment, as well as documented risk factors such as age, family history, and race/ethnicity. In Brazil, most published studies did not separately demonstrate a statistically significant difference in the prevalence of prostate cancer in Black versus White patients (11)(12)(13)(14)(15)(16)21,22). Notwithstanding, several of these studies showed a tendency toward a higher prevalence of prostate cancer in Black men (11,13,21), suggesting that a low sample bias may have been responsible for non-significant statistical results.…”
